				| Hi, I am new to WorkFlow. I have set data to the in container and when I am trying to retrive it from the outcontainer am getting an exception. The following is my code. 
 ProcessTemplate[] templates = _workflowConnection.queryProcessTemplates("NAME = '" + _templateName + "'",	null,null);
 ReadWriteContainer inputContainer = myTemplate.initialInContainer();
 
 try {
 ContainerElement[] containerElements = workItem.outContainer().leaves();
 for (int i = 0; i < containerElements.length; i++)
 {
 if (containerElements[i].fullName().indexOf("workflow")== -1)
 {
 try
 {
 fields.put(containerElements[i].fullName(),containerElements[i].getString());
 }
 catch (FmcException fmcException)
 {
 continue;
 }
 }
 }
 WorkItem.setOutContainer(inputContainer);
 return myTemplate.createAndStartInstance2("Leave Process",null,null,inputContainer,false);
 }
 
 
 Now when I am trying to get the values form the outcontainer, I am getting an exception "Object value not set"
 
 Could any one please help me in this.

	| I have set data to the in container and when I am trying to retrive it from the outcontainer am getting an exception. |  I haven't looked at the code but you should be getting from Input Container and setting to Output Container.
